Segmentul UNS din standardul UN/EDIFACT este adesea trecut cu vederea în proiectele EDI, deși joacă un rol critic: marchează granița dintre secțiunea de detalii (linii) și secțiunea de sumar într-un mesaj (de exemplu INVOIC, DESADV, ORDERS). În practică, UNS are valori tipice precum “UNS+S’” pentru a începe sumarul și “UNS+D’” pentru a începe detaliile. Pentru arhitecturi ERP moderne în cloud – SAP S/4HANA, Oracle Fusion Cloud ERP și Microsoft Dynamics 365 – înțelegerea modului de mapare a segmentului UNS în lanțul EDI–traductor–ERP este esențială pentru conformitate, trasabilitate și reducerea erorilor operaționale.
De ce contează UNS în fluxurile EDI
UNS nu transportă date de business; el oferă control de secțiune. Traductoarele EDI folosesc UNS pentru a valida că totalurile din sumar corespund cu liniile din detalii, că segmentele sunt în ordinea corectă și că mesajul respectă ghidurile (de ex. GS1 EANCOM pentru retail și FMCG). Lipsa sau poziționarea incorectă a UNS poate declanșa respingeri la hub-uri EDI ale unor retaileri mari (Carrefour, Tesco, Walmart), chiar dacă restul segmentelor par valide. Pentru echipele IT, asta înseamnă timpi de remediere și penalități SLA.
UNS în SAP: Integration Suite B2B, IDoc și add-on-uri
În ecosistemul SAP, UNS este consumat în zona de traducere/mediere EDI, nu în aplicație. Tipic:
- Traducere EDI în SAP Integration Suite (B2B add-on), OpenText Trading Grid sau SEEBURGER BIS. Aici, UNS este validat și folosit pentru a delimita maparea între segmentele de linii (LIN, QTY, PRI) și sumar (MOA, CNT).
- Maparea către IDoc-uri (ex. ORDERS05, DESADV, INVOIC02) nu include un câmp “UNS”; în schimb, se configurează regulile de agregare: de exemplu, MOA+77 (total factura) din secțiunea după “UNS+S’” se mapează la E1EDK01-BTWRB, iar totalurile de linii la E1EDS01.
- Validarea EDI în PO/PI sau SAP Integration Suite poate compara suma liniilor din detalii cu totalurile din sumar, folosind poziția UNS ca punct de separație. La erori, se declanșează Acknowledge EDI (CONTRL/APERAK) cu coduri corecte.
Din 2024, SAP a accelerat adopția cloud; veniturile din cloud au înregistrat creșteri de peste 20% și backlog-ul cloud a atins recorduri, alimentând proiecte EDI pe S/4HANA Public/Private Cloud. În aceste proiecte, regula practică rămâne: UNS se gestionează în stratul EDI și nu se “persistă” în tabelele ERP.
UNS în Oracle: B2B pentru Fusion Cloud ERP
Oracle B2B (componentă folosită atât on-prem SOA Suite, cât și în integrarea cu Fusion Cloud ERP) gestionează EDIFACT și EANCOM, incluzând UNS:
- UNS este validat de motorul EDI; dacă lipsește într-un mesaj care îl cere conform ghidului, Oracle B2B marchează mesajul ca invalid în raportarea de runtime.
- Maparea către Fusion Cloud ERP se face prin payload-uri REST/SOAP fără UNS; secțiunile sunt deja separate logic de către translatorul EDI, care livrează liniile și sumarul ca entități business coerente (ex. Invoice header/lines + totals).
- În Trading Partner Agreements se configurează ghidul EDI (de ex. EANCOM 2002/2010), cu reguli ce implică poziția UNS pentru validarea totalurilor (MOA) și numărului de segmente (CNT).
Oracle a raportat în 2024 creșteri cu două cifre pentru Fusion Cloud ERP, iar NetSuite a înregistrat în mai multe trimestre creșteri de peste 20%, ceea ce susține migrarea către fluxuri EDI standardizate în cloud, cu control strict al structurii, inclusiv UNS.
UNS în Dynamics 365: Azure Logic Apps și Integration Account
În peisajul Microsoft, EDI pentru Dynamics 365 Finance & Supply Chain se implementează frecvent cu Azure Logic Apps + Enterprise Integration Account:
- Conectorul EDIFACT decodează mesajele și validează UNS conform schemelor (de ex. EANCOM D.01B). În mod implicit, UNS e folosit pentru validare; nu ajunge în payload-ul JSON decât dacă se configurează explicit “preserveInterchange”.
- Maparea din JSON către entitățile Dynamics 365 (Purchase orders, ASN, Invoices) separă clar “lines” și “summary”, deoarece UNS a segmentat deja mesajul. Totalurile (MOA) de după “UNS+S’” se mapază în capul documentului, iar “LIN/PIA/QTY/PRI” înainte de UNS intră în linii.
- Monitorizare în Azure Monitor și Log Analytics: alertele pentru lipsa UNS sau pentru nepotriviri între linii și sumar ajută SLA-urile EDI.
Ghid practic de mapare și validare EDI
- Tratați UNS ca mecanism de control EDI, nu ca dată business. Maparea în ERP se face pe baza poziției relative față de UNS, nu printr-un câmp dedicat.
- Întăriți regulile de validare în translator: controlați că suma MOA la nivel de sumar corespunde agregării QTY/PRI din detalii și că CNT reflectă numărul real de segmente până la UNS.
- Folosiți ghidurile GS1 EANCOM actualizate pentru industrii retail/FMCG; multe hub-uri EDI ale comercianților impun explicit prezența UNS în INVOIC și DESADV.
- Automatizați testele: creați fișiere EDI “pozitive” și “negative” (UNS lipsă, UNS duplicat, UNS plasat greșit) și validați pipeline-ul end-to-end în SAP, Oracle sau Dynamics 365.
Date de piață și context
Piața EDI continuă să fie relevantă în 2024–2025, susținută de cerințe stricte din retail, auto, farma și logistică. GS1 menționează utilizarea largă a standardelor sale (inclusiv EANCOM) în lanțurile globale. În paralel, creșterea accelerată a ERP-urilor cloud – SAP S/4HANA, Oracle Fusion Cloud ERP, Microsoft Dynamics 365 – a împins tot mai multe companii să-și mute integrarea EDI în servicii gestionate, cu validare avansată a structurii mesajelor, unde segmentul UNS rămâne piesă-cheie.
Capcane frecvente și cum le evitați
- Ignorarea UNS în custom mappers: rezultă totaluri eronate și respingeri EDI.
- Transformări incomplete la split: lipsa agregării după UNS duce la facturi fără sume finale în ERP.
- Inconsecvențe între ghidurile partenerilor: folosiți profile per-partener și versiuni EDIFACT/ EANCOM explicite.
Concluzie
În proiectele EDI moderne, segmentul UNS este un controlor structural discret, dar indispensabil. În SAP, Oracle și Dynamics 365, el se gestionează în stratul de traducere EDI, ghidând maparea corectă între detalii și sumar și permițând validări robuste. Consolidarea regulilor în traductoare, testarea negativă și monitorizarea proactivă reduc respingerile, scurtează timpii de remediere și cresc încrederea în datele din ERP. Pe măsură ce ERP-urile cloud accelerează, arhitecturile EDI care tratează corect UNS vor livra scalabilitate, conformitate și cost total de operare redus pentru IT și business.
